Easter Brunch Casserole

An Easter brunch casserole is a hearty, versatile dish that combines fresh vegetables, eggs, bread, and a flavorful topping to create a crowd-pleasing meal. Perfect for holiday gatherings, this casserole can be prepared ahead of time, making it easy to serve a large group with minimal stress. It’s a wonderful way to incorporate seasonal ingredients while offering a satisfying mix of textures and flavors.

Ingredients for a Classic Easter Brunch Casserole

  • Eggs, either whole or vegan substitutes for a plant-based option
  • Milk, cream, or non-dairy milk for vegan versions
  • Seasoned bread cubes to create a soft, custard-soaked base
  • Fresh vegetables such as bell peppers, onions, spinach, and corn
  • Optional cheeses like cream cheese, shredded cheddar, or vegan alternatives
  • Herbs and spices for added flavor, such as salt, pepper, parsley, and thyme

Preparation Steps

  1. Preheat your oven to the recommended temperature and lightly grease a baking dish.
  2. Prepare your bread cubes and layer them evenly in the dish.
  3. In a m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s and milk (or vegan substitutes) and season to taste.
  4. Layer the chopped vegetables evenly over the bread cubes, followed by your choice of cheese.
  5. Pour the egg mixture over the casserole, ensuring it evenly soaks the bread and vegetables.
  6. Top with a crumb or streusel topping if desired for extra texture.
  7. Bake in the oven until the casserole is golden brown and set in the middle, usually around 35–45 minutes.
  8. Let it cool slightly before serving to allow flavors to meld together.

Serving Tips

  • Cut into squares or scoops to serve family-style on a platter.
  • Pair with fresh fruit, salads, or pastries for a complete Easter brunch spread.
  • Garnish with fresh herbs or a sprinkle of cheese for visual appeal and extra flavor.
  • This casserole can be made a day ahead and refrigerated, making holiday morning preparation stress-free.
